Etymology[edit]

Derived from Latin interpellāre, from inter- (between) + pellere (to drive).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): [interpelaˈt͡sii]
  • Audio:
    (file)
  • Rhymes: -ii
  • Hyphenation: in‧ter‧pe‧la‧ci‧i

Verb[edit]

interpelacii (present interpelacias, past interpelaciis, future interpelacios, conditional interpelacius, volitive interpelaciu)

  1. to interpellate, to insert
